Kylian Mbappé — The Teenage Boy Who Shocked The World


In football history, there are moments when the world suddenly realizes that a new superstar has arrived. For many fans, that moment came during the 2018 FIFA World Cup in Russia, when a 19-year-old Kylian Mbappé exploded onto the biggest stage in football and changed his life forever.

At the time, Mbappé was already considered a massive talent. People in France talked about his incredible speed, confidence, and technical ability. Some even called him “the next Thierry Henry.” But being talented and becoming a global icon are two completely different things. The World Cup would become the tournament that transformed Mbappé from a promising young player into one of the most feared footballers on Earth.

What made his rise even more special was how fast everything happened.

Just a few years before dominating the world stage, Mbappé was a teenager dreaming of success like millions of other kids. He grew up in Bondy, a suburb near Paris. Football was everywhere around him. His father worked as a football coach, while his mother was a professional handball player. Sports were part of his life from the beginning.

Even as a child, coaches immediately noticed something different about him.

It was not only his speed. Many young players are fast. Mbappé had something more dangerous — fearlessness. He played without hesitation. He attacked defenders directly, took risks, and played with confidence beyond his age. Videos of him destroying defenders in youth football quickly spread online. Soon, major clubs across Europe were paying attention.

As a kid, Mbappé admired Cristiano Ronaldo more than anyone else. In fact, one famous photo shows young Mbappé sitting in his bedroom surrounded by posters of Ronaldo on the walls. Years later, fans would look back at that image and realize how unbelievable his journey became.

His breakthrough came at AS Monaco.

During the 2016–17 season, Monaco shocked European football. They played exciting, aggressive attacking football and defeated huge clubs along the way. Mbappé became the face of that young team. Defenders struggled to stop him because he combined explosive speed with calm finishing and intelligent movement.

Suddenly, the entire football world was talking about him.

Then came the 2018 World Cup.

France entered the tournament with enormous pressure. Their squad was filled with stars, but many people still doubted whether such a young team could handle the expectations. Mbappé, meanwhile, looked completely fearless from the start.

In the group stage, fans could already see flashes of brilliance. But everything changed in the Round of 16 against Argentina.

That match became legendary.

Argentina had Lionel Messi. France had a teenager who was about to announce himself to the world.

From the first whistle, Mbappé looked unstoppable. His pace terrified defenders every time he touched the ball. Early in the match, he picked up the ball deep inside his own half and sprinted through Argentina’s defense with unbelievable speed. The run was so explosive that defenders could only stop him by fouling him inside the penalty area.

The football world exploded with reactions online.

But Mbappé was only getting started.

Later in the game, he scored twice in incredible fashion. Every touch felt dangerous. Every sprint created panic. Argentina’s defenders looked helpless trying to stop him. France won the match 4–3 in one of the greatest World Cup games ever played.

After the final whistle, people everywhere asked the same question:

“Is this the future of football?”

Even legendary players were stunned. Comparisons to Pelé immediately started appearing in headlines around the world. Mbappé suddenly became more than a talented youngster — he became the symbol of football’s next generation.

But the biggest moment was still waiting.

France reached the World Cup final against Croatia. The pressure was enormous. Millions of people watched around the world as Mbappé prepared for the biggest match of his life at just 19 years old.

Most teenagers at that age are still trying to discover who they are.

Mbappé was preparing to play in a World Cup final.

And he delivered.

France defeated Croatia 4–2, and Mbappé scored in the final itself. With that goal, he became only the second teenager in football history to score in a World Cup final after Pelé. The image of Mbappé celebrating with pure joy instantly became iconic.

At just 19 years old, he had already achieved what many footballers never accomplish in an entire lifetime.
